The Meaning Of Peace
This was actually one of the first songs I've heard of Koda Kumi's and one of the reasons I got into her. The Meaning Of Peace is a collaboration between Koda Kumi and Korean/Japanese singer BoA and it was somewhat of a hit when it came out. This collaboration, I'm sure, got both of these talented artists more fans because they work together really well and their voices harmonize with each other perfectly. It's a really nice, addicting melody and something I'll never stop enjoying to listen to. BUT
BUT is the title track of the single with the same name released in March 2007. When this song first came out and I listened to it, I loved it (of course I still do!). The beat is just so catchy and Kumi sounds at her best in here. Sure, the video was a bit controversial and caused some kind of an uproar in Japan, but she looked great in there. It's like a mix between an addicting, hip-hop piece with some rock added to it.
